We stopped in on our first night in Tbilisi. Unfortunately they were out of khachapuri! We did have the first of many pots of lobio. This one came with a great array of pickled vegetables. We also had the roast half chicken with potatoes and...phkali. The phkali was just ok. Maybe some pomegranate seeds would have spruced it up. We also had a carafe of white wine. We ordered quite a bit and still the bill was quite low. Lots of food! The courtyard is very comfortable, and we really enjoyed it. Lots of dogs and cats roaming around, but all minding their own business. A group of kittens kept us visually entertained. Google says they stay open late, but we saw many turned away, as the kitchen does not stay open as long. Check ahead if you're a night owl. Loved our meal here, fun spot.More
